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0403370 66 751916 49
02943890283 7943343120 788744
02943890283 7943343120 788744
23 72213 989 591
All about undefined
Interested in learning more?
02943890283 7943343120 788744
23 72213 989 591
See more
06 1054884243
2656 5674067 2027116033 858
See more
81 62
667 685 49 3941100848
See more